Bruce: Washington supports the Syrian Government in combating terrorism and ensuring st

Published: 2025/06/25 1:27 PM
Updated: 2025/12/31 3:48 PM
Bruce: Washington supports the Syrian Government in combating terrorism and ensuring st

Washington, SANA-The United States has renewed its condemnation of the terrorist bombing that targeted St. Elias Church in al-Dweilaa neighborhood of Damascus, expressing its support for the Syrian government in fighting terrorism.

In a press briefing last night, U.S. State Department spokesperson Tammy Bruce stated, “The United States supports the Syrian government in combating forces seeking to destabilize the region and spread fear in Syria and across the Middle East.”

Bruce reaffirmed on Wednesday the U.S. commitment to supporting Syria in its fight against terrorist groups, noting that Washington has lifted several sanctions to facilitate assistance to the Syrian government in strengthening its counterterrorism capabilities. This move is part of broader international efforts to ensure stability in Syria and the region.

U.S. Special Envoy to Syria Thomas Barak also strongly condemned on Tuesday the terrorist attack, stressing that this cowardly act would not undermine Syria’s diverse national identity or the unity of its people.
